1 14 3/4-ounce can Alaska salmon, drained and flaked
1 pound penne pasta
1 teaspoon liquid smoke
1/2 cup white wine
1 cup clam juice
1 teaspoon garlic, minced
1 shallot, minced
3/4 cup evaporated skim milk
1/2 tablespoon cornstarch
Fresh dill, chopped, to taste
Salt and pepper, to taste
Olive oil cooking spray
Servings: 8
1. Mix cornstarch with 2 tablespoons of evaporated skim milk, hold aside.

2. Spray a sauté pan with cooking spray, add garlic, dill, shallot and 2 tablespoons of wine and cook for 2 minutes. Add the clam juice, liquid smoke and 3/4 of the salmon; cook for 5 minutes. Remove to a blender or food processor and process to your desired consistency. Add the cooked pasta and toss; cook to heated through. Taste, adding salt and pepper as needed. Serve, garnished with additional dill.

Makes 6-8 servings.
